Solipsistic is the debut album for Semantic Saturation; a progressive rock/metal project founded by guitarist Shant Hagopian in 2010. The debut album was released in 2013 featuring Virgil Donati, Ric Fierabracci, Derek Sherinian and Andy Kuntz.
Solipsistic consists of nine tracks, the first eight of which are instrumental, with the final track titled “What if We All Stop” bearing Andy Kuntz’s signature vocals. The epic song spans over 8 minutes, transitioning from a calm, mellow beginning towards an eagerly-anticipated heavier mid-section, before it reaches a grand finale capturing the essence of prog-rock along the way.
